Fans will be seeing a purple track (跑道) at the Olympics when athletes (运动员) try to set records at this summer’s Paris Games. The Olympics used to choose red-brick clay color (砖红色). An Olympic track is going purple for the first time.
“The look of the Games includes three colors for all the competition places: blue, green and purple. We decided on this purple track with different tones(色调) : lighter for the track, darker for the service areas, and grey for the turns at the end of the corner,” said Alain Blondel, the sports manager (经理), who added that the choice of the color reminds us of lavender (薰衣草).
This purple color, never seen before for an athletics track, has been the result of a long process but it doesn’t have to be just beautiful. “We had to work hard on the colors so that they came out in the best possible tones to highlight (突出) the athletes. It’s a track and it has to be pretty, but above all it’s a stage (舞台) on which the athletes are going to perform. What’s really important is that the colors and the athletes stand out,” said Alain Blondel.
Different colors can lead to different emotions and feelings. For example, red makes people feel excited; blue helps lower stress, while purple has some of the good points of both red and blue, which can encourage athletes to perform at their best and help them bring good results.
Many athletes in the world will compete on the beautiful purple track at the Paris Olympics from August 1st-11th 2024.

Today, many people celebrate (庆祝) birthdays in the same way. There’s a birthday cake, balloons, candles, and maybe some gifts. Do you know how and where these birthday celebrations started?
Birthday cake
The link (联系) between cakes and birthday celebrations may start in ancient Roman times (古罗马时代). In the 15th century, Germans (德国人) began to spread (传播) the idea of eating cakes on birthdays, and then birthday cake was born.
Birthday candles
Some people think that the history of putting candles on a cake began in ancient Greece (古希腊). People put candles on a cake to show their love for the moon goddess (女神), Artemis. They made round cakes and put candles on the cake to make it glow (发亮) like the moon. Then they made wishes before blowing out the candles. They thought that the smoke (烟雾) from the candles could bring their wishes to the gods and goddesses. Today, many think that the birthday person must make a wish before blowing out the candles. If they blow out all the candles in one go, the wish will come true.
Birthday song
If there’s one thing that lets someone know it’s your birthday, it’s the Happy Birthday Song. So where did the song come from? People think the song’s melody (旋律) came from a school teacher’s greeting song called Good Morning to All. American sisters Mildred and Patty Hill wrote it in 1893.
Now that you know a lot about the history of birthday celebrations, it’s time to get the party started!
